About Asian Institute For Distance Education

AIDE IN PERSPECTIVE

The Asian Institute for Distance Education was established in April, 1984, as a project of the Filipinas Foundation. Initially, it offered a two-year course, the Associate in Arts, and a baccalaureate program, the Bachelor of Arts, with majors in English, Economics, History, Sociology and Political Science. In February, 1985, it was authorized by the Bureau of Higher Education to offer the Bachelor of Science in Business Administration, major in Management.

In 1988, AIDE spun off from Filipinas Foundation and was incorporated as an educational foundation.

The Bachelor of Arts program with the various majors was converted in 2005 to the Bachelor of Arts in English, and the Bachelor of Arts in Political Science, thus phasing out the other major programs.

Thus, AIDE is now offering the following program:

  • Bachelor of Science in Business Administration Major in Marketing Management
  • Bachelor of Science in Business Administration Major in Human Resource Management
  • Bachelor of Science in Business Administration Major in Business Economics
  • Bachelor of Science in Business Administration Major in Financial Management
  • Bachelor of Science in Business Administration Major in Operations Management
  • Bachelor of Arts in English Language
  • Bachelor of Arts in Political Science

In June, 2004, AIDE was authorized by the Bureau of Immigration and Deportation to accept foreign students, subject to its rules and regulations.
